全面解析TPWallet接口:功能、应用及开发指南
随着区块链技术的迅速发展,数字资产的管理变得愈发重要。TPWallet作为一个数字钱包解决方案,提供了接口供开发者与其生态系统进行交互。本文将全面解析TPWallet接口的功能与应用,帮助开发者更好地理解和利用这一工具。另外,将针对用户常见的几个问题进行深入探讨,确保读者对于TPWallet有一个全面的认识。
什么是TPWallet?
TPWallet是一个为用户提供多种数字资产存储、管理和交易功能的数字钱包。TPWallet支持多种区块链资产,包括但不限于主流的比特币、以太坊、TRON等。除了基础的资产管理功能外,TPWallet还提供了丰富的API接口,方便开发者在其应用中集成钱包功能。
TPWallet接口的优势是什么?

TPWallet接口的主要优势包括:
- 多链支持:TPWallet接口允许用户同时管理不同区块链的资产,大大提高了资产管理的便利性。
- 安全性高:TPWallet采用了智能合约和多重签名技术,有助于提升用户资产的安全性。
- 易于集成:TPWallet提供的接口文档详尽,易于理解,使得开发者能快速上手。
TPWallet接口的基本功能有哪些?
TPWallet接口提供了多种基本功能,包括但不限于:
- 钱包创建:允许用户创建新的数字钱包,分配相应的公钥和私钥。
- 资产转账:支持用户通过接口进行资产的转账交易。
- 查询余额:用户可以通过接口查询其钱包的当前余额情况。
- 交易记录:提供查询历史交易记录的功能,便于用户进行管理。
如何使用TPWallet接口进行开发?

进行TPWallet接口开发的步骤通常包括:
- 注册账户:用户需要在TPWallet平台注册账户,获取API Key。
- 环境搭建:搭建开发环境,准备合适的开发工具进行接口测试。
- 接口调用:借助API文档的帮助,开发者就可以开始调用相应的接口进行开发。
用户常见问题解答
1. TPWallet接口的安全性如何保证?
TPWallet采用多种安全机制来保证用户数据和资产的安全性。首先,TPWallet的私钥采用加密存储。在创建钱包的过程中,私钥会经过加密处理,只有用户本人才能解密。此外,TPWallet还实现了多重签名机制,确保每次交易都需要多个账户的签名,从而提高交易的安全性。
此外,TPWallet还使用智能合约技术,智能合约是自执行的合约,由代码管理,其中包含条件和执行逻辑。这种结构使得交易的透明性和不可篡改性大大提升。用户的每笔交易都会被记录在区块链上,保持公开和透明,减少了人为干预的可能性。
最后,TPWallet还支持两步验证的安全措施,当用户尝试进行重要操作(例如转账或大金额交易)时,系统会发送短信或邮件进行验证,进一步降低了安全风险。
2. TPWallet接口的调用限制有哪些?
虽然TPWallet接口为开发者提供了丰富的功能,但依然会有一定的调用限制。这些限制主要基于API调用频率、数据存取量和请求的并发数。这是为了防止服务滥用,确保用户体验。一般来说,TPWallet会提供API的调用频率限制,例如每分钟最多调用100次,超过则需要等待。
此外,TPWallet可能会对不同的服务设置不同的调用限制。某些高级功能,如资产的大额转账,可能会由于安全原因而被限制调用频次。而且,开发者在使用接口时,还需注意一些操作的权限,部分调用可能需要特定的权限授权(例如钱包管理权限)。
3. 如何解决调用TPWallet接口时遇到的常见错误?
当开发者在调用TPWallet接口时,常常会遇到各种错误。常见的错误包括API Key无效、余额不足、参数错误等。针对这些问题,开发者可以采取如下措施来进行排查和解决:
- 检查API Key:确保所使用的API Key在TPWallet平台中是有效的,并且没有过期。若需要更新,需按步骤重新生成新的API Key。
- 核对交易参数:当进行交易时,一定要仔细核对输入的参数是否与接口要求一致。特别是对于金额、地址等敏感信息,错误的参数会导致交易失败。
- 查看日志:记录并查看接口调用的日志,日志中通常会包含错误详细信息,帮助开发者发现问题所在。
- 访问社区支持:如果自己无法解决,开发者可以获取TPWallet社区的支持,寻求帮助或者查看过去的问题记录。
4. TPWallet未来的发展趋势如何?
TPWallet的未来发展趋势将在以下几个方面体现:
- 支持更多区块链:预计TPWallet将会继续扩展其支持的区块链类型,适应更加多样的资产管理需求。
- 功能多元化:TPWallet将围绕用户需求,推出更多的金融服务功能,例如借贷、质押等,增强钱包的功能性。
- 提升用户体验:不断对用户界面及API进行,提升用户使用体验,让开发者能更轻松地实施API,简化开发过程。
- 安全性的不断提升:随着行业安全需求的提高,TPWallet也会不断加强其安全措施,采用更先进的技术保护用户资产与信息。
综上所述,TPWallet接口不仅为用户提供了多种数字资产管理的功能,也为开发者提供了丰富的开发工具。希望通过本文的介绍,能让您对TPWallet有一个更全面的理解,并推动您在开发过程中的应用与探索。